Output e694031adca7adf1f630bf0a4a101012e0d18fa947236be451c01819ab44b1c5:0

value
696675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ec46407a5d1b981a2258255e2f7567942064941c OP_EQUAL
address
3PEKZ11jHaFMxXYQroZYJ4VFpZPUsuMcPh
transaction
e694031adca7adf1f630bf0a4a101012e0d18fa947236be451c01819ab44b1c5
confirmations
207801
spent
true